Computer Science MSc
计算机科学 理学硕士硕士
该计算机科学硕士课程非常适合希望从事软件开发职业但本科未学习计算机科学的学生。我们的数字世界依赖于可靠、高质量的计算机系统,从医院、银行到手机和汽车,无处不在。这些系统通过庞大而复杂的网络相互连接,处理着海量的个人与公共数据,其重要性正在迅速增长。
尽管如此复杂,其背后仍由一组核心的计算机科学原理驱动。本课程将帮助你理解这些基础理论,使你能够参与塑造技术的未来。你将学习软件工程、数据库系统、面向对象编程以及现代人工智能等关键技能,并将理论与实际应用相结合。
我们将帮助你成长为一名自信的问题解决者,扎实掌握概念与实用工具。你将获得宝贵且持久的技能,为进入众多行业的高回报职业打开大门,并有能力对使用技术的个人和组织产生积极影响。
申请要求
中国学生需持有四年制学士学位。录取依据上海软科世界大学学术排名(ARWU)划分院校层次,并对应不同均分要求:
- Top 250院校:均分67%–80%(对应英制2:2至一等学位);
- 251–500名院校:均分70%–83%;
- 501+名院校:均分75%–86%。
附属学院学生按所属大学排名适用相同标准。部分商科、管理、金融或创意艺术类专门院校享有特殊考量(仅限体育、运动与健康科学学院及体育商业研究所课程)。不完全符合要求者,若具备相关专业背景、核心课程成绩优异或丰富工作经验,可个案审核。
语言要求
总分6.5,且每项测试均不低于6.0
| 科目 | 总分 | 阅读 | 听力 | 口语 | 写作 |
|---|
雅思 | 6.5 | 6.0 | 6.0 | 6.0 | 6.0 |
托福总成绩为 88 分,各项测试成绩均不低于 21 分。
PTE 总成绩为 65 分,且各项子测试成绩均不低于 61 分。
| 科目 | 总分 | 阅读 | 听力 | 口语 | 写作 |
|---|
PTE | 65 | 61 | 61 | 61 | 61 |
开学与申请日期
2026
| 开学日期 | 申请开始日期 | 申请截止日期 | 申请状态 |
|---|
| 2026-09 | - | 2026-08-24 50天 | - |
课程描述
第一学期包含四门必修课程,每门15学分,共60学分。
1. 编程基础:旨在帮助学生将计算机科学基本概念与现代编程语言中的实现相对应,理解单条指令的执行过程,并掌握版本控制仓库在软件开发中的作用。
2. 数据库系统:培养学生数据推理能力,涵盖数据库生命周期的各个环节,包括抽象建模、具体实现、CRUD操作(创建、读取、更新、删除)以及权限管理。
3. 算法与数据结构:使学生能够分析计算问题的时间复杂度,熟练使用现代编程语言的库来选择合适的算法与数据结构,并具备阅读和编写伪代码的能力。
4. 软件工程:介绍现代软件工程的工具、技术、术语和目标,比较不同软件工程范式的特征,并为学生提供协作开发软件项目的实践环境。
所有模块均为必修,旨在夯实学生在编程、数据管理、算法设计和团队开发方面的基础能力。